Hello @lgc,

While upgrading MariaDB itself from 10.5.x to 10.11 is generally supported by MariaDB, OpenIAM has not officially certified this upgrade path for OpenIAM 4.2.1.13.

If you’re planning this upgrade for an existing deployment, we recommend testing it in a non-production environment first. Our engineering team is currently evaluating support for newer MariaDB versions as part of our platform compatibility efforts for the OpenIAM 2026.x.x release line. MariaDB 10.11 is supported with the OpenIAM 2026.x.x release line on EL10. For OpenIAM 4.2.1.x, the supported MariaDB versions are:

  • EL8: MariaDB 10.3
  • EL9: MariaDB 10.5

We’ll update our documentation once validation is complete.
